Pyramis Global Advisors has begun offering its large-cap core 130/30 strategy to institutional clients, said spokesman Alexi Maravel. The strategy, which the firm seeded more than a year ago, delivered a 33.6% return for the year through June 30, besting the S&P 500s 20.6% gain for the same period, and leaving it at the top of the 130/30 universe covered by eVestment Alliance for the trailing one-year period, Mr. Maravel said. The strategy will seek to outperform the benchmark by an annualized 4% over a market cycle. John Power, senior vice president of domestic equities, is team leader for the strategy, overseeing seven sector portfolio managers running concentrated long/short sector portfolios, supported by 20 global fundamental research analysts within Pyramis and parent company Fidelitys broader research organization.
